How to Keep Your CMS Secure From Hackers

How to Keep Your CMS Secure From Hackers

In today’s digital landscape, ensuring the security of your Content Management System (CMS) is paramount. With cyber threats on the rise, it’s crucial to implement robust security measures to protect your website. Here are effective strategies on how to keep your CMS secure from hackers.

1. Regularly Update Your CMS

One of the simplest yet most effective ways to maintain CMS security is to keep your platform up to date. Developers frequently release updates to patch vulnerabilities. Regularly check for updates and apply them as soon as they become available to avoid exploitation by hackers.

2. Use Strong Passwords

Weak passwords are an open invitation for cybercriminals. Ensure that all users associated with your CMS are utilizing strong, unique passwords. A combination of upper and lower case letters, numbers, and special characters is recommended. Additionally, consider implementing a password manager to help users create and remember complex passwords.

3. Implement Two-Factor Authentication (2FA)

Adding an extra layer of security can significantly reduce the risk of unauthorized access. Two-factor authentication requires users to verify their identity using a second method, such as a code sent to their mobile device. This added step makes it much harder for hackers to gain access to your CMS.

4. Limit User Access

Not everyone needs access to every part of your CMS. Implement a role-based access control system to limit user privileges based on their roles. By giving users only the access they need, you can minimize the chances of a security breach stemming from compromised accounts.

5. Choose a Secure Hosting Provider

Your hosting provider can significantly impact your CMS's security. Opt for reputable hosting services that offer robust security measures, such as firewalls, secure server configurations, and regular backups. A reliable host will also provide support in case of security incidents.

6. Regularly Backup Your Data

Backing up your website data can save you from significant losses in case of a security breach. Schedule regular backups and ensure that they are stored in a secure location. In the event of an attack, you can quickly restore your website to a previous state, minimizing downtime.

7. Monitor Activity Logs

Keeping an eye on activity logs can help you identify any suspicious behavior. Many CMS platforms provide log features that allow you to monitor user activity. Regularly reviewing these logs can help you spot unauthorized access attempts and respond promptly.

8. Employ Security Plugins and Tools

Consider using security plugins specifically designed for your CMS. These tools can provide additional features such as malware scanning, firewall protection, and security audits. Implementing these measures can significantly enhance your site's security posture.

9. Educate Users About Security

Human error remains a significant factor in security breaches. Educate your team about best practices for online security, including recognizing phishing attempts and the importance of secure password management. Training can empower users to take an active role in keeping your CMS secure.

10. Stay Informed About Security Threats

The digital security landscape is continually evolving, making it essential to stay informed about the latest threats. Subscribe to security blogs, forums, or newsletters focused on CMS security. Awareness of current trends can help you proactively safeguard your website.

In conclusion, keeping your CMS secure from hackers requires a proactive approach involving regular updates, strong passwords, 2FA, user access control, and ongoing education. By implementing these strategies, you can significantly reduce the risk of security breaches and protect your valuable content.